ICE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review

1,022 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Intercontinental Exchange (ICE)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$46.1B — down 0.42% from $46.3B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 161 funds opened new ICE positions and 33 closed out — a net gain of 128 holders — while 380 added to existing stakes and 344 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$346M. The largest seller was T. Rowe Price Associates, cutting an estimated $1.28B.
